Northrop Grumman is looking for a Manager Electronics Engineering 3 for the Digital Products Department - an organization of 100+ engineers that develop digital hardware units for space applications, including modulators, demodulators, command and telemetry units and digital communication products. The successful candidate should possess people, processes and project management skills and understand all phases of unit development, including but not limited to proposal and costing, requirements derivation, design, verification, and testing, as well as the tools that enable success during the unit development lifecycle.

Northrop Grumman leads the industry team for NASA’s James Webb Space Telescope, the largest, most complex and powerful space telescope ever built. Launched in December 2021, the telescope incorporates innovative design, advanced technology, and groundbreaking engineering, and will fundamentally alter our understanding of the universe.
